VERMILION PARISH, LA. (KLFY) -- Eight-year-old Allori Eurigues from Forked Island East Broussard Elementary was surprised with a trip to Disney World by the Dreams Come True of Louisiana organization.

Allori, who was diagnosed with spinal muscular atrophy at birth, received the surprise as a birthday gift. Her family had kept the trip a secret until the big reveal, which was organized by the nonprofit Dreams Come True of Louisiana.

"She is a very tough girl, she deals with a lot, and she is very strong. And now she gets her dream come true from Dreams Come True," said Crystal Eurigues, Allori's mother.

Spinal muscular atrophy is a rare neuromuscular disorder that results in the loss of motor neurons and progressive muscle wasting, affecting Allori's muscular abilities in her face.
